Year-over-year, workers in the construction industry continue to face various safety hazards and risks while on the job. In fact, according to OSHA, “every year in the U.S. more than 800 construction workers die and nearly 137,000 are seriously injured while on the job.”1

To help enhance worker and worksite safety across the construction industry, MSA has signed on as a capstone supporter of the Associated General Contractors of America (AGC).

MSA and AGC: Shared Values as Industry Leaders

Established in 1914, MSA Safety is the global leader in the development, manufacture and supply of safety products. As an AGC capstone supporter, MSA aims to provide AGC members with industry-leading fall protection PPE, Type I and Type II hard hats and safety helmets, connected gas detection solutions, and comprehensive in-person and online training to help enhance worker safety at their jobsite. With safety experts located across the country, MSA offers a solid network of support to AGC members, ready to help find the PPE, safety solutions, and training to help meet the needs of their unique jobsites and applications.

As “the voice of the construction industry,” AGC is “an organization of qualified construction contractors and industry related companies dedicated to skill, integrity and responsibility.”2 Similar to MSA, AGC has been in existence for more than 100 years. Recognized as the oldest and largest construction association, AGC’s membership consists of the country’s leading general contractors, specialty-contracting firms, service providers, and suppliers. With a nationwide network of local chapters, AGC aims to educate its members about what’s new in construction techniques and technology, while connecting construction professionals with each other.3

Together, the MSA and AGC partnership brings together two longstanding industry leaders committed to worker safety, education, and support.
